The Senior Technical Architect leads the design of resilient architectural solutions, focusing on cloud-native systems, integration patterns, and promoting engineering excellence within the organization.
The Senior Technical Architect is a pivotal role within the Group IT Architecture Chapter. You will lead the design and delivery of high-performance, high-quality architectural solutions that drive exceptional value for internal users and millions of our customers. As a technical authority, you will be responsible for maintaining architectural blueprints and ensuring standardized, resilient, and secure designs across Agile, Platform, Infrastructure, and Data teams.
RequirementsKey Responsibilities
1. Architectural Strategy & Blueprinting
- Develop and maintain comprehensive architectural blueprints for the Group, ensuring alignment with the ENBD long-term technology strategy.
- Define and enforce common architectural standards (Resiliency, Reliability, and Security - RRS) across all digital and banking platforms.
- Lead the "Chapter" of architects, ensuring consistent modeling practices and knowledge sharing across diverse tribes.
2. Solution Design & Agile Delivery
- Collaborate with Agile squads and Platform teams to design end-to-end technical solutions for complex banking initiatives.
- Act as the bridge between business requirements and technical execution, translating needs into scalable, cloud-native architectures.
- Oversee design modeling across all enterprise layers (Business, Data, Application, and Technology - BDAT).
3. Engineering Excellence & Governance
- Champion a "build-from-within" engineering culture by minimizing vendor dependency and maximizing in-house innovation.
- Govern the lifecycle of architecture solutions, identifying and mitigating technical debt and performance bottlenecks.
- Review and approve High-Level Designs (HLD) and Low-Level Designs (LLD), ensuring they meet the bank’s stringent data security standards.
4. Mentorship & Chapter Leadership
- Mentor and coach architects and engineers working within Agile, Infrastructure, and Data teams.
- Conduct educational workshops and peer-review sessions to foster a culture of technical innovation and continuous improvement.
BenefitsRequired Skills & Experience
- Experience: 10–14+ years in IT, with at least 5 years as a Solutions/Technical Architect within the Banking or Financial Services (BFSI) sector.
- Technical Stack: Proficiency in cloud-native technologies (Containers, Kubernetes/OpenShift), Microservices architecture, and real-time messaging (KAFKA).
- Integration: Deep understanding of system integration patterns and APIs (REST, JSON, XML).
- Standards: Expertise in industry frameworks like TOGAF 9.x/10 and ArchiMate.
- Automation: Working knowledge of scripting (Python, PowerShell) and CI/CD automation pipelines.
- Strategic Mindset: Ability to balance immediate delivery needs with long-term architectural stability.
- Stakeholder Management: Exceptional communication skills for interacting with Department Heads and cross-functional leadership.
- Agile Proficiency: Deep understanding of Scrum/Agile frameworks and the "Chapter/Tribe" operating model.
- Bachelor’s/Master’s Degree in Computer Science, IT, or a related field.
- Preferred: TOGAF Certification and experience with banking-specific security/regulatory mandates.

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ene
To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
